
Logan Murdock, Raja Bell, and Howard Beck discuss Game 3 of the NBA Finals, where the San Antonio Spurs defeated the New York Knicks 115–111. What did it take for the Spurs to earn their first win of the series on the road in the hostile environment of Madison Square Garden? Was Game 3 too physical? One host thinks so. Howard Beck, who was in attendance, also shares his firsthand perspective on a epic night at MSG. Plus, the mailbag!
